MeshCore Analyzer
Self-hosted, open-source MeshCore packet analyzer — a community alternative to the closed-source
analyzer.letsmesh.net.
Collects MeshCore packets via MQTT, decodes them, and presents a full web UI with live packet feed, node map, channel chat, packet tracing, per-node analytics, and more.

⚡ Performance (v2.1.1)
Two-layer caching architecture: in-memory packet store + TTL response cache. All packet reads served from RAM — SQLite is write-only. Heavy endpoints pre-warmed on startup.
| Endpoint | Before | After | Speedup |
|---|---|---|---|
| Bulk Health | 7,059 ms | 1 ms | 7,059× |
| Node Analytics | 381 ms | 1 ms | 381× |
| Topology | 685 ms | 2 ms | 342× |
| Node Health | 195 ms | 1 ms | 195× |
| Node Detail | 133 ms | 1 ms | 133× |
See PERFORMANCE.md for the full benchmark.

Config lives in the data volume at /app/data/config.json — a default is created on first run. To edit it:
docker exec -it meshcore-analyzer vi /app/data/config.json
Or use a bind mount for the data directory:
docker run -d \
--name meshcore-analyzer \
-p 3000:3000 \
-p 1883:1883 \
-v ./data:/app/data \
meshcore-analyzer
# Now edit ./data/config.json directly on the host
Theme customization: Put theme.json next to config.json — wherever your config lives, that's where the theme goes. Use the built-in customizer (Tools → Customize) to design your theme, download the file, and drop it in. Changes are picked up on page refresh — no restart needed. The server logs where it's looking on startup.

| Field | Description |
|---|---|
port |
HTTP server port (default: 3000) |
https.cert / https.key |
Optional PEM cert/key paths to enable native HTTPS (falls back to HTTP if omitted or unreadable) |
mqtt.broker |
Local MQTT broker URL. Set to "" to disable |
mqtt.topic |
MQTT topic pattern for packet ingestion |
mqttSources |
Array of external MQTT broker connections (optional) |
mqttSources[].name |
Friendly name for logging |
mqttSources[].broker |
Broker URL (mqtt:// or mqtts:// for TLS) |
mqttSources[].topics |
Array of MQTT topic patterns to subscribe to |
mqttSources[].username / password |
Broker credentials |
mqttSources[].rejectUnauthorized |
Set false for self-signed TLS certs |
mqttSources[].iataFilter |
Only accept packets from these IATA regions |
channelKeys |
Named channel decryption keys (hex). Hashtag channels auto-derived via SHA256 |
defaultRegion |
Default IATA region code for the UI |
regions |
Map of IATA codes to human-readable region names |

MQTT Setup
MeshCore packets flow into the analyzer via MQTT:
- Flash an observer node with
MESH_PACKET_LOGGING=1build flag - Connect via USB to a host running meshcoretomqtt
- Configure meshcoretomqtt with your IATA region code and MQTT broker address
- Packets appear on topic
meshcore/{IATA}/{PUBKEY}/packets
Alternatively, POST raw hex packets to POST /api/packets for manual injection.
Architecture
Observer Node → USB → meshcoretomqtt → MQTT Broker → Analyzer Server → WebSocket → Browser
→ SQLite DB
→ REST API
